The purpose of a furnace condensate trap is to collect and remove water that forms during the heating process. This helps prevent water from entering the furnace and causing damage. The condensate trap contributes to the efficient operation of a heating system by ensuring that the furnace functions properly and efficiently without being affected by excess moisture.
If a clothes dryer is heating but not drying, it could be due to a blockage in the dryer vent, a clogged lint trap, or a faulty heating element. Check for obstructions in the vent system and lint trap, and ensure the heating element is working properly. If these components are clear and functional, it could indicate a problem with the dryer's airflow or moisture sensors that may require professional repair.
Yes, glass is often used in solar heating systems to trap heat from the sun and enhance the greenhouse effect, allowing for heating of the interior space. The glass allows sunlight to enter while preventing heat from escaping, thereby increasing the temperature inside the system.

The purpose of the under sink trap in a plumbing system is to prevent sewer gases from entering the living space and to trap debris to prevent clogs in the pipes.
The purpose of a condensate drain trap in an HVAC system is to prevent air from escaping or entering the system while allowing water to drain out.

A trap instruction is a software interrupt. It's generated by an error or by a user program when it needs the operating system to perform an operation (a system call).
